This medium-angle, full shot captures the entrance of a public transport microbus or bus in Cairo, Egypt, during daylight hours. The interior shows several passengers. One person in a white sweatshirt and dark trousers stands near the entrance, holding onto a white bag. Other passengers are seated further inside, with their heads and upper bodies partially visible; one woman wears a light-colored headscarf, another a darker one. Black handrails are visible for standing passengers. The exterior of the vehicle is blue and white, with red and white striped safety markings along the edge of the open doorway. A yellow Egyptian license plate, "GR2 5544", is affixed to the exterior near the entrance steps. The bright, clear blue sky is visible at the top left, indicating good weather. The side of the bus features signage in Arabic. A prominent blue panel states "محافظة القاهرة" (Governorate of Cairo), "هيئة النقل العام" (Public Transport Authority), and "مشروع النقل الجماعي" (Mass Transit Project). Below this is "الانجليز" (Al-Engliz), "ARM", and "elizya". Adjacent to this, a black and white sign lists various routes and destinations, including "مطريه" (Matareya), "الجديد التجمع الأول" (New Tagamoa El Awal), "حلمية" (Helmeya), "هارون - سفير" (Haroun - Safir), "الحي العاشر - زهراء" (Tenth District - Zahraa), "ميدان الاسماعليه - صلاح الدين" (Ismailia Square - Salah El Din), and "كلية البنات" (Girls' College). A "BONDO" logo and a Chevrolet emblem are also visible on this sign. The partial phrase "بسم الله" (Bismillah) can be seen on the far left. The scene depicts daily life and public transportation in Cairo, with passengers entering or exiting the vehicle.
